The Benefits Of Using A Poultry Waste Incinerator

The poultry industry generates a significant amount of waste, including carcasses, feathers, manure, and other byproducts. Proper disposal of this waste is essential to prevent environmental pollution and public health risks. One effective solution for managing poultry waste is the use of a poultry waste incinerator. In this article, we will explore the benefits of using a poultry waste incinerator and how it can help poultry farms and processing plants efficiently manage their waste.

A poultry waste incinerator is a specially designed system that burns poultry waste at high temperatures, reducing it to ash and gases. This process not only helps in the disposal of waste but also provides several benefits to poultry farms and processing plants. One of the primary benefits of using a poultry waste incinerator is the reduction of waste volume. By incinerating poultry waste, the volume of waste is significantly reduced, making it easier to handle and dispose of the remaining ash. This can be particularly useful for poultry farms with limited space for waste storage.

Furthermore, incinerating poultry waste can help prevent the spread of diseases. Poultry waste can contain harmful pathogens and bacteria that can pose a threat to the health of workers and the surrounding community. By incinerating the waste at high temperatures, these pathogens are effectively destroyed, reducing the risk of disease transmission. This is especially important for biosecurity in poultry farms, where disease outbreaks can result in significant economic losses.

Another significant benefit of using a poultry waste incinerator is the production of heat and energy. Poultry waste is a rich source of energy that can be harnessed through incineration. By burning poultry waste, heat is generated, which can be used to power the incinerator itself or converted into electricity through steam turbines. This provides poultry farms and processing plants with a renewable energy source that can help reduce their reliance on fossil fuels. Additionally, the heat produced can be used for heating purposes, such as heating poultry houses or water for sanitation.

In addition to heat and energy production, a poultry waste incinerator can also help reduce greenhouse gas emissions. When poultry waste decomposes naturally, it releases methane, a potent greenhouse gas that contributes to climate change. By incinerating poultry waste, methane emissions are eliminated, reducing the environmental impact of poultry farming. This can be particularly beneficial for poultry farms looking to reduce their carbon footprint and comply with sustainability regulations.

Moreover, using a poultry waste incinerator can help improve air quality. poultry waste incinerators are equipped with advanced emission control systems that filter out harmful pollutants before they are released into the atmosphere. This helps prevent air pollution and protects the health of workers and nearby residents. By investing in a high-quality incinerator with proper emission control technology, poultry farms can ensure that they are operating in an environmentally responsible manner.
